We are delighted to welcome Rachel de Thame to our festival this year, a broadcaster, writer and gardener, and a familiar face to viewers as a regular presenter on Gardeners’ World and many other gardening shows.
Her work spans major design and curatorial projects, including the Chelsea Flower Show and the Thames Diamond Jubilee Pageant Royal Barge. Rachel is also an ambassador and supporter of many charities that include Patron of the British Iris Society, and an Ambassador for the Hardy Plant Society. Gardening for wellness and wildlife is at the heart of everything she does.
In her talk, Rachel will explore the close connection between gardening and physical and mental health, celebrating how simply being in nature is linked to our wellbeing. This follows seamlessly into the needs of essential pollinators and other wildlife that share our gardens. Rachel will then suggest plants and practical choices that support these vital creatures year-round while bringing joy and beauty to our outdoor spaces.

After the talk, we invite you to enjoy the gardens at Gravetye Manor at this special event celebrating the life of their creator, pioneering Victorian gardener William Robinson.
